  2. 25 Sep 2011 · Cotyledonary: Multiple, discrete areas of attachment called cotyledons are formed by interaction of patches of allantochorion with endometrium. The fetal portions of this type of placenta are called cotyledons, the maternal contact sites (caruncles), and the cotyledon-caruncle complex a placentome.   3. A mature placenta weighs about 500–600 grams and consists of 15–28 “cotyledons.” The stem villus is the major structural unit of the fetal cotyledon. Each cotyledon begins with a stem villus that divides into 3-5 immature/mature intermediate villi, which further branches into 10–12 terminal villi (Figure 3.1B). Some terminal villi ...

  4. 6 Feb 2022 · After delivery, the mature placenta consists of 15 to 28 subunits designated as “cotyledons”, which are perfusion chambers partly or completely separated from others by connective tissue and irrigated by one or more maternal spiral arteries. Each cotyledon contains one or more fetal villous tree(s), a fetal artery, and a vein.

  5. 6 Mac 2021 · At all times there is a syncytial layer that separates maternal blood in intervillous lakes from foetal tissue of the villi. The septa divide the placenta into compartments called cotyledons. Cotyledons receive their blood supply through 80-100 spiral arteries that pierce the decidual plate.

  6. 26 Okt 2023 · Also visible on the maternal surface of the placenta are slightly elevated regions called lobes or cotyledons (approximately 10 to 40), which are separated by grooves or sulci. Inside the placenta, the grooves correspond to the placental septa.

  7. The maternal surface of the placenta should be dark maroon in color and should be divided into lobules or cotyledons. The structure should appear complete, with no missing cotyledons.
